Every Great Organization Begins With a Simple Belief

or Anderson Treatment, that belief came from our founder, Jody Anderson, who saw firsthand the challenges individuals and families face when seeking help for substance use and mental health. She recognized that recovery is about more than treating addiction. It’s about restoring hope, rebuilding relationships, and helping people create lives they never thought were possible. 

Driven by that belief, Jody founded Anderson Treatment with a clear mission: to provide compassionate, evidence based care where every individual is treated with dignity, respect, and genuine understanding. 

From the beginning, Anderson was never meant to be just another treatment provider. It was built to be a place where people felt seen, supported, and empowered to succeed. Every person who walked through our doors deserved not only quality clinical care, but also encouragement, accountability, and a team that truly believed in their ability to recover.

As our community's needs grew, so did Anderson.

What began with a single vision expanded into a comprehensive behavioral healthcare organization offering residential treatment, outpatient services, medication assisted treatment, recovery housing, programs for pregnant and parenting women, adolescent services, and integrated mental health care. Each new program was created with one purpose in mind: ensuring that individuals and families could find the right level of care at every stage of their recovery journey.

Today, Anderson Treatment remains proudly family owned and locally operated. While we have grown in size and expanded the services we provide, the values that inspired our beginning remain at the heart of everything we do.
